The patient provides three positive responses to items on the CAGE (Cut down, Annoyed, Guilty, Eye-opener) query.
What interpretation should the nurse provide to the patient?
One positive response indicates the patient should seek help with alcohol addiction.
All responses to the CAGE Questionnaire must be positive to suggest alcohol dependence.
The CAGE Questionnaire is a tool used to identify general substance abuse.
At least two positive responses are strongly suggestive of alcohol dependence.
The Correct Answer is D
Choice A rationale
While any positive response on the CAGE questionnaire could be a cause for concern and warrant further investigation, one positive response does not definitively indicate that the patient should seek help with alcohol addiction. The CAGE questionnaire is a screening tool used to identify potential problems with alcohol, but it is not diagnostic. A healthcare provider would need to conduct a more thorough assessment to diagnose alcohol addiction.
Choice B rationale
It is not necessary for all responses to the CAGE questionnaire to be positive in order to suggest alcohol dependence. The CAGE questionnaire is a screening tool, and while a greater number of positive responses increases the likelihood of alcohol dependence, it is not a requirement for all responses to be positive. A score of two or more is considered clinically significant.
Choice C rationale
The CAGE questionnaire is indeed a tool used to identify potential problems with alcohol, but it is not used to identify general substance abuse. The CAGE questionnaire specifically asks about feelings related to alcohol use. There are other screening tools available that are designed to identify issues with other substances.
Choice D rationale
This is the correct answer. The CAGE questionnaire is a validated screening tool that is widely used in clinical settings to detect alcoholism. It is considered positive, and suggestive of alcohol dependence, if two or more questions are answered affirmatively.

Management of respiratory distress in a long-term smoker requires knowledge of oxygen delivery systems and airway humidification. The nurse must apply principles of respiratory therapy to select equipment that ensures precise flow regulation and moisture addition to prevent mucosal drying during supplemental oxygen administration.
Choice A rationale: Lamb’s wool is occasionally used to protect skin from pressure sores caused by medical tubing. However, it is not a standard or essential component for initiating oxygen therapy, as modern medical-grade foam dressings or specialized tubing protectors are more commonly utilized in clinical practice.
Choice B rationale: Sterile water is essential for the humidification process when oxygen flow rates exceed 4 liters per minute. It serves as the reservoir liquid in the humidifier bottle to ensure the inhaled gas is moist, preventing the drying of sensitive respiratory mucosa and secretions.
Choice C rationale: Tape is generally avoided when securing nasal cannulas because it can cause skin irritation or breakdown on the face. The cannula is designed to be secured using the integrated sliding bolo or by looping the flexible tubing comfortably behind the patient's ears.
Choice D rationale: A suction canister is used for removing secretions from the oropharynx or trachea. While it may be present at the bedside for safety, it is not a functional component of the oxygen delivery system itself, which focuses on gas inhalation rather than extraction.
Choice E rationale: A humidifier bottle is necessary to add water vapor to the dry oxygen gas provided by the wall source. Humidification is vital for patient comfort and to maintain the integrity of the mucociliary escalator, especially for patients with chronic lung irritation from smoking.
Choice F rationale: The nasal cannula is the primary interface for delivering low-to-medium concentrations of oxygen. It consists of two prongs that fit into the nares, allowing the patient to breathe supplemental oxygen while still being able to speak and consume fluids or meals.
Choice G rationale: A flowmeter is a critical device that attaches to the oxygen wall outlet to regulate the liters per minute delivered. It allows the nurse to accurately titrate the oxygen dose according to the healthcare provider's specific orders and the patient's oxygenation needs.
